Figure 17 in Evidence for Carboniferous origin of the order Mantodea (Insecta: Dictyoptera) gained from forewing morphology
Figure 17. Wing venation of specimen IWC OB 239, belonging to Hoplocorypha sp. (♂; abbreviations: CuA, anterior cubitus; CuP, posterior cubitus; AA, anterior analis; RA, anterior radius). A, left forewing, ventral view. B, detail of the origin of the anterior branch of posterior radius (RP*), as located on A; arrow without label indicates the origin of (the posterior branch of) RP*.
